Liquid Screen Protector: Simply put, a liquid screen guard can’t go face to face with toughened glass when it comes to providing complete protection from impact. However, the downside is that it can shatter under severe impacts, such as a significant drop. It can withstand most minor drops and falls, as well as scratches from something as sharp as a knife. Tempered Glass: Tempered glass is much stronger than liquid protectors and offers 9H hardness. Simply clean your screen, apply a few drops of the liquid glass, and then rub with the cloth provided as instructed. Liquid Screen Protector: A liquid protector, on the other hand, is more straightforward to apply with the dropper and cloth provided in the package. The curved edges allow for bubble-free installation. However, many of the latest tempered glass covers come with easy-application kits and instructions that help you out. If it’s not done correctly, air bubbles or smudges can form on your screen. Tempered Glass: A tempered glass screen protector can be tricky to apply.

So, unlike tempered glass, you don’t need to get any specific size for your phone. Moreover, it can be used on any type of phone or other device such as the Apple Watch. The transparent oleophobic layer fends off scratches and smudges. It sets into a hard coating when applied to your display. It boasts 9H hardness which can withstand scratches from objects as sharp as a knife.Ī liquid screen protector consists of nano liquid technology and is basically liquified glass. Tempered glass is about five times stronger than regular glass. Liquid screen protectors consist of a bottom layer of absorbent silicon, combined with a PET film and oleophobic coating on the top. Tempered glass is a thin sheet of toughened, fortified glass that sticks to your phone screen to protect against damage such as scratches or cracks. tempered glass, and which is the best form of defense against scratches, smudges, and cracks.
